The cart is empty

Zimbra Collaboration Suite (ZCS) is a comprehensive suite for email communication, calendars, and collaboration, offering businesses a flexible and scalable solution for their communication needs. Implementing Zimbra on a Virtual private server (VPS) provides organizations with control over their data while leveraging the benefits of Cloud infrastructure. This article provides a detailed guide on setting up and using Zimbra Collaboration Suite on VPS.

Prerequisites and Requirements

Before installing Zimbra, ensure that your VPS meets the following requirements:

  • Modern operating system (e.g., Ubuntu 20.04 LTS or CentOS 8)
  • Minimum 8 GB RAM for production deployment
  • Minimum 50 GB of free disk space
  • Full root access
  • Properly configured DNS records (A, MX)

Installing Zimbra Collaboration Suite

  1. System Update:

    • Ubuntu/Debian: sudo apt update && sudo apt upgrade -y
    • CentOS/RHEL: sudo yum update -y
  2. Setting Hostname:

    • Change the hostname of your VPS to a fully qualified domain name (FQDN) that you will use for Zimbra: sudo hostnamectl set-hostname mail.yourdomain.com
  3. DNS Setup:

    • Ensure that an A record for mail.yourdomain.com and an MX record pointing to this A record are properly set up in DNS.
  4. Installing Zimbra:

    • Download the latest version of Zimbra Collaboration Suite from the Zimbra website.
    • Extract the downloaded archive and run the installation script: tar xzvf zcs-*.tgz && cd zcs-* && ./install.sh

During the installation, you will be asked several questions regarding configuration; it is recommended to use the default settings and make finer adjustments after the installation is complete.

Basic Configuration

After installation, access the Zimbra administration interface via the web at https://mail.yourdomain.com:7071. For the initial login, use the username admin and the password obtained during installation.

  1. Creating User Accounts:

    • Go to "Manage" > "Accounts" and create new user accounts according to your organization's needs.
  2. Domain Setup:

    • In the "Configure" > "Domains" section, you can add additional domains if you plan to use Zimbra for multiple domains.
  3. SSL/TLS Configuration:

    • It is recommended to configure SSL/TLS certificates for securing communication. You can use certificates from authorities such as Let's Encrypt.

Using Email, Calendar, and Collaboration

Zimbra offers a rich set of features for email, calendar, contacts, and collaboration:

  • Email: A robust email client with support for rules, filters, and integration with external accounts.
  • Calendar: Shared calendars with support for invitations, events, and meetings.
  • Contacts: Centrally managed contact directory with the ability to share contacts among users.
  • Zimlets: Extensions that allow integration with external applications and services.

Zimbra Collaboration Suite on VPS is a powerful solution for email, calendar, and collaboration, offering organizations flexibility and control over their communication tools. With the installation and basic configuration guide, you are now ready to start using Zimbra to streamline communication in your organization.